    mahn, just get a clear tube, about 1/4 inch dia, coil it from the caliper bleed fitting up to the top of the spring and down to a container.
    start with the furtherest away, like rear left and open the bleeder fitting, then s l o w l y pump the pedal full travel, keep an eye on the contents of the reservoir and when just about empty, rush around and lock off the fitting. at this stage your tube should be full of fluid. just follow siut with the others and it should work.
    don't let the reservoir get empty.
    edit - you must keep the free end of the tube in fluid.
